How Immigration Can Help Manufacturing's Labor Shortage
U.S. manufacturers face a compounding labor crisis. A 2024 Deloitte and Manufacturing Institute study projects a need for 3.8 million new workers by 2033, with nearly half of those roles at risk of going unfilled. Retirements are accelerating the gap, and entry-level roles such as production helpers, packers, and warehouse workers see chronically high turnover.
